I'm taking 1-2 shakes per day. Each shake is roughly:
1 cup berries
1 cup oats
1 scoop protein powder
3 raw eggs
1 cup broccoli

i blend it to liquid form. Wanted to double check if this will spike insulin or something since I'm blending it up. Not sure if that changes things.

In between the fiber in the berries/oats/broccoli and the fat in the eggs, you won't be getting any sudden glucose or insulin spike. The dietary fiber and the fat should slow the release of the carbs and protein, given you a nice, steady stream of nutrients.
